Some VIN decoding services, typically those designed for commercial use, allow users to submit the VIN pattern (characters 1-8, 10, and 11) as well as the full 17-digit VIN.VINs with 13 digits relate to vehicles manufactured before 1981. The first digit is the country of origin and the second the manufacturer. The third digit represents the vehicle type, and the fourth through the eighth designates the engine type, braking system, body style, and restraint system.Most vehicles have a VIN, a unique identification code of 17 characters (numbers and letters). It contains information about the manufacturer and production date. Most often, the year of manufacture is in the 10th position of the VIN.On NHTSA. NHTSA’s VIN decoder is publicly accessible at: https://vpic.To find out which one applies to your VIN, you must look at the 7th letter or number in your VIN. If the 7th VIN position is a letter, then your vehicle is made in 2010 through 2039. If the 7th VIN is a number, then your vehicle is made prior to 2010.Use a VIN Decoder When using a vehicle VIN decoder, compare key specs like engine type, body style, year of manufacture, and transmission. If anything looks off, that’s a red flag. In this case, you should verify the authenticity of the VIN by performing a title check and accessing vehicle history.

How do you check the VIN number on a Mercedes?

Check the Corner of the Dashboard: Stand outside your car on the driver’s side and inspect the corner of the dashboard where it and the windshield meet. You should be able to find the VIN there. WHERE CAN I FIND MY VIN? The VIN can be found on the VIN plate located on the driver’s side of the dashboard just below the windshield (1). The VIN can also be found on the driver-side doorframe label (2), as well as on documents related to the vehicle’s registration, title and insurance.
